Environmental Specialist

Job Description

The Environmental Specialist works in the field handling hazardous waste and supporting environmental compliance for a wide range of clients. In this role, you work as part of a team to perform lab pack services, conduct chemical inventories, and complete audits and inspections at client facilities and laboratories. You contribute to the development of standard operating procedures, support key accounts, and demonstrate leadership through daily interactions with team members and clients.

Responsibilities

  • Work in the field with hazardous waste, ensuring safe handling, packing, and disposal in accordance with regulatory and company standards.
  • Perform lab pack services, including chemical segregation, labeling, packing, and preparation of materials for disposal.
  • Conduct chemical inventories at client sites, accurately documenting materials, quantities, and storage conditions.
  • Perform audits and inspections of facilities and laboratories to assess compliance with environmental, health, and safety requirements.
  • Assist leadership in developing and supporting key accounts by providing consistent, high-quality service and identifying process improvements.
  • Help develop and refine standard operating procedures to improve safety, efficiency, and consistency of field operations.
  • Demonstrate supervisory and leadership skills through daily interactions with team members, providing guidance, support, and positive example in the field.
  • Collaborate closely with a crew of 2–5 people, including a team lead, to complete daily assignments safely and efficiently.
  • Interact with clients on-site in a professional and personable manner, explaining services, answering questions, and representing the organization positively.
  • Perform physically demanding tasks, including lifting, moving, and packing chemical containers and equipment as part of daily field work.
  • Operate and care for company vehicles and field equipment while traveling to and from various client locations.
  • Adapt to changing daily assignments, client sites, and tasks, maintaining flexibility and strong attention to safety and detail.

Work Environment

This role is 100% field-based, working on-site at various locations throughout the Greater Boston area, including biopharmaceutical and life science companies, hospitals, and higher education institutions. There is no typical day, as assignments vary by client and project, providing exposure to diverse environments and tasks. Each day begins by reporting to the Somerville-area office, where you meet your crew and then travel together in a company vehicle to one or more client sites. You typically work on a crew of 2–5 people, including a team lead who provides guidance, direction, and support throughout the day. Standard workdays are approximately 8–10 hours, starting around 6:00 or 7:00 a.m., and involve physically active, hands-on tasks in laboratory, industrial, and institutional settings. The organization offers a strong culture of internal growth, with a structured advancement program for permanent employees that provides promotions and raises over a 2–2.5 year period. Most leadership team members have advanced from within, creating a supportive environment for professional development, field experience, and extensive client interaction.
